Just wondering if anyone else with a 3rd Gen has this issue.

When i fitted my wiper arms back on the car after spraying them they were fine, until one day the arms adjusted themselves and the drives side on hit the side of the windscreen.

Then today i was driving and then left hand and right hand arms got stuck together in the middle of my windscreen, and then after a few more clicks of the stalk the drivers side on is somehow hanging off the side of the car.

Yes, its hilarious. Especially if it happens to someone else. If it happened to my car, I'd be worried about the wipers twisting and scratching the glass, or bending the linkages.

Try setting them straight and tightening the nuts that hold them on. If they still move about after that the splines on the shafts are probably stripped - put some loctite in there. A common problem with the rear wiper on the wagons.

Loctite will keep them on, but you may have trouble getting them off later. lol

Maybe, if the splines on the arms or spindles are stripped, get some from a wreckers? Not much of a job to remove and replace. Might just be the wiper arms that have stripped.
